I have been in contact with my Wakhi guide from the trip I took in 2018, Ibrahim Hamdard.

He says that tourists are finally starting to trickle back in now, post Taliban take over. Apparently there are a couple of Americans there right now (with two Taliban armed escorts).

He says that while the border crossing at Ishkashim is still closed, apparently you can cross into Kunduz province at Sherkhan Bandar. Supposedly the consulate in Khorog is issuing visas. (I would confirm this border crossing info elsewhere, it is not really in Ibrahim’s wheelhouse).
